This year, I took sheets of chipboard, punched all the frames out of them and used the remnants. Originally the sheet was 12"x12" and I cut it down to be 6"x12". I used Chocolate Chip Craft Ink to color the chipboard and then embossed it with clear embossing powder. Now.. some of you might ask, "Where dd the flecks come from?" I used my friend Jan's Embossing Powder that had been contaminated with White Embossing Powder -- it makes for a nice effect, don't you think?
I used Bella Sara paper in the frames that don't have a photo of Bradleigh in them. Bradleigh's name was printed on Cardstock Vellum and the verse "Dreams come in a size too big so we can grow into them. The large B was cut using The Big Shot and San Serif Die then accented with Felt Flowers and Rhinestone Brads.
I added a cardboard easel, purchased a Michael's, on the back so that it could be placed on a table. I hope they liked it -- the hardest part was narrowing down the photos I chose to use!
